The Trust are seeking a qualified Electrician to join the Estates Maintenance Team working at our Rotherham Doncaster and South Humber sites. You will be part of a great team who are responsible for the delivery of a comprehensive maintenance and installation service across the Trust's estate. The post attracts a band 5 salary plus overtime + on call allowance + any call out payments.
The Trust and the Head of Service are committed to technical development of our staff with great opportunities for further training and support in career development.
Applicants must hold NVQ level 3 qualifications and have undertaken an accredited apprenticeship. You will be carrying out maintenance and installation work across our Trust properties and work with a variety of our specialist contractors and engineers on a variety of systems. Our aim is to provide our patients and staff with compliant, safe, and pleasant environments to work in. You will enjoy working with all our clinical staff, nurses, doctors, and corporate staff to support them in their work.
To carry out the repair, maintenance or installation of all plant, equipment, systems and building structure/fabric associated with all Trust properties. This will consist of planned preventative maintenance (PPMs), testing and calibration, fault finding, emergency response, defect correction and minor works.
You will be employed to work appropriate to your core skills around building and engineering plant and equipment maintenance. You will progressively be trained, where required, to acquire other skills with the intention of reaching levels of multi trade flexibility and competence. You will have some Competent Person duties for which training will be provided and will participate in the crafts persons on call rota. You will work closely with the Senior Technicians to improve planned maintenance.
